Handover note — Crumbwheel order cutoffs.

Welcome aboard. The bakery cutoff rule in Crumbwheel closes same-day orders at 14:00 local to each storefront, not UTC — this has bitten us twice. Holiday overrides live in the calendar service and take precedence silently, so always check there first when a cutoff looks wrong. To unlock the calendar service's admin console after a restart, enter the recovery passphrase below.

vault phrase of bagap-bahaf = silion-pelox-sorox-casdor-quenwyn-fraax-eliox-praael-kelion-quenvan-kasox-rusael-norius-belvan

## Sensor drift: what to do at 3am

If the GrowLoop controller starts reporting humidity swings that don't match the backup probes in the Fernwick greenhouse, it's almost always sensor drift, not an actual climate event. Don't panic and don't touch the vents manually. First, restart the calibration daemon and give it ten minutes to re-baseline. If readings still disagree by more than 5%, flip the controller into safe mode. The safe-mode thresholds it will use are these.

config for yahap-bajof:
[istix]
host = istix.qorvelsys.internal
user = istix_svc
database = istix_prod

## Tuning

The Tillhouse pricing experiment adjusts ticket prices per demand bucket every refresh cycle. If prices oscillate, widen the damping factor first; don't kill the job unless margins go negative. All knobs are hot-reloaded from config, no deploy needed. Page the pricing owner before changing floors. Current constants are listed below.

tuning constants:
QUOTAS = {
    "druwyn": 5,
    "holix": 5,
    "zorath": 5,
    "holwyn": 10,
}